ClassCastException when binding service

I am following the tutorial from Bound service : http://developer.android.com/guide/components/bound-services.html and use it in my code. But when I use the code from the tutorial I get an error at this line : service = binder.getService(); cannot convert from localService to IBinder. So as a solution I cast it to IBinder. But I get a classCastException then when I start running the app.

This is the code from the MainActivity :

/** Defines callbacks for service binding, passed to bindService() */
private ServiceConnection mConnection = new ServiceConnection() {

    @Override
    public void onServiceConnected(ComponentName className, IBinder service) {
        // We've bound to LocalService, cast the IBinder and get LocalService instance
        LocalBinder binder = (LocalBinder) service;
        service = (IBinder) binder.getService();
        mBound = true;
    }

    @Override
    public void onServiceDisconnected(ComponentName arg0) {
        mBound = false;
    }
};


@Override
protected void onStart() {
    super.onStart();
    // Bind to LocalService
    Intent intent = new Intent(this, LocalService.class);
    bindService(intent, mConnection, Context.BIND_AUTO_CREATE);
}

@Override
protected void onStop() {
    super.onStop();
    // Unbind from the service
    if (mBound) {
        unbindService(mConnection);
        mBound = false;
    }
}

The code in my service looks like this :

public class LocalService extends Service implements LocationListener,
GooglePlayServicesClient.ConnectionCallbacks,
GooglePlayServicesClient.OnConnectionFailedListener,
com.google.android.gms.location.LocationListener, SensorEventListener {


/**
     * Class used for the client Binder.  Because we know this service always
     * runs in the same process as its clients, we don't need to deal with IPC.
     */
    public class LocalBinder extends Binder {
        LocalService getService() {
            // Return this instance of LocalService so clients can call public methods
            return LocalService.this;
        }
    }

    @Override
    public IBinder onBind(Intent intent) {
        return mBinder;
    }
}

Use:

service = (LocalService) binder.getService();

... instead of:

service = (IBinder) binder.getService(); 

You are calling a Service object and trying to type cast it to a IBinder object it is giving to a ClassCastException.
